My shrimp and grits recipe.
2 tablespoons real butter 2 cups chicken broth 1/2 cup heavy whipping cream 1 and 1/2 cups instant grits 1 tablespoon texas pete or other hot sauce 1 oz cheddar cheese. 1 cup leftover fried or boiled shrimp
saute shrimp in butter, add chicken broth, bring to a boil, add grits, stir, add hot sauce, stir, add cheese, finally add cream and cook slowly for 20 minutes. Cooking time is much longer for REAL grits.
